Tributes have actually been paid to a Ukrainian army medic who passed away on the cutting edge fighting Russian soldiers.
Olga Semidyanova, 48, was fatally hurt throughout a fight on the border in between Donetsk and Zaporizhzhia in the south of Ukraine on March 3.
The mum-of-12 had actually served in the army because 2014, and it has actually been declared she continued combating after much of her system had actually been eliminated.
Her household think she was shot in the stomach, however they have actually been not able to recuperate her body due to ongoing combating in the location, leaving them troubled.
Her child, Julia informed The Sun: ‘She conserved the soldiers to the last.
‘We have photos from the place of death — but due to heavy fighting we still can’ t bury my mom.’
Olga, who had the honorary title ‘Mother Heroine’ had 12 kids, consisting of 6 she had actually embraced from a regional orphanage.
She resided in the city of Marhanets around 150 miles from where she was eliminated.
The title ‘Mother Heroine’ is provided to ladies who have actually had more than 5 kids.
Her children have actually led homages to their mum online while members of the Ukrainian federal government have actually likewise paid their aspects.
Anton Gerashchenko, an advisor to the nation’s Interior Ministry, stated: ‘She was killed in a conflict with Russian hooligans.
‘Even when she believed her regiment might not survive, she emphasised her desire to protect the country until the end. She is a national hero. She is a hero to me.’
Marina Ivanchenko stated on Facebook: ‘This Ukrainian woman is truly a hero.’
Another user stated: ‘RIP Olga Semidyanova, hero of Ukraine defender of Europe.’
Ukrainian president Volodymyr Zelensky stated previously today that an approximated 1,300 Ukrainian soldiers have actually been eliminated because Russia attacked on February 24, although the real number is not understood.
The verified civilian death toll in Ukraine is 691 individuals with a more 1,143 injured the United Nations Human Rights Office has actually stated on Tuesday.
But the UN has stated the real civilian figures are most likely to be ‘considerably higher’ due to extreme hostilities in some locations and reporting hold-ups.
The combating has actually led more than 3 million individuals to run away Ukraine, the UN quotes.
